Our criminal defense team represents individuals and corporations who have been charged with any manner of criminal offenses. We advise and represent clients who are under investigation, have been formally charged or are seeking post-conviction relief or appeal.

Kegler Brown's criminal defense attorneys have represented numerous clients in some of the state's most high-profile trials. Our practice leader, Mike Miller, is a former FBI agent, municipal court judge, and long-time Franklin County prosecutor.

Our Clients

Our individual clients seek us out for reasons ranging from traffic violations to allegations of serious criminal activity. Juvenile representation includes adolescents charged in traffic court, as well as cases involving allegations of drug possession or underage drinking in municipal and mayors’ courts. We also represent college students charged with student conduct violations.

Our lawyers also represent corporations and their leaders in a wide range of criminal matters stemming from business operations, including securities violations, criminal antitrust violations (e.g., bid-rigging and price fixing), criminal matters involving environmental issues or hazardous materials handling, embezzlement, and international conduct involving the Foreign Corrupt Practices Act.
